Mega-Sena draws this Tuesday a cumulative prize of R$ 10.5 million

-

The six dozen of Mega-Sena competition 2,707 will be drawn, starting at 8 pm (Brasília time), at Espaço da Sorte, located on Avenida Paulista. No. 750, in São Paulo.

The draw will be broadcast live on Loterias Caixa’s social networks on Facebook and Caixa’s YouTube channel. The prize is accumulated at R$10.5 million.

If just one player wins the main prize and invests the entire amount in savings, he or she will receive almost R$60,000 in income in the first month.

Bets can be placed until 7pm (Brasília time) at lottery stores accredited by Caixa, across the country or online. The simple game with six numbers marked costs R$5.

Timemania

Timemania will also draw, this Tuesday (2), an accumulated prize of R$ 24 million for contest 2,074. The modality is a specific prediction product in which the bettor chooses ten dozens out of 80 and a Heart Team out of 80 possible.

Seven dozens and a Heart Team will be drawn. Bets that match three to seven numbers or the team win.

If just one player takes the main prize and invests it in savings, he or she will receive more than R$134,000 in income in the first month. The bet costs R$3.50.
